Transaction 11760636a333f0fdd284994f91c3381d6a1db5cd5dc84d1bafdad967cfe75a87

2 Input
2 Outputs
  • 11760636a333f0fdd284994f91c3381d6a1db5cd5dc84d1bafdad967cfe75a87:0
  • value  13000000
    address  1DmPWEpttjWUJ1SoeEDWKnCGkyrsspmVQM
  • 11760636a333f0fdd284994f91c3381d6a1db5cd5dc84d1bafdad967cfe75a87:1
  • value  118460
    address  16L6LkQHb6H9B7h2EajWTSHuWTopj51pjx